Which of the following can be beaten into sheets?
A. Sulphur
B. Aluminum
C. Chlorine
D. Fluorine

Hint: This question gives the knowledge about metal and its properties. Metals are the substances which possess high thermal and electrical conductivity. They are electropositive in nature. Metals can be beaten into very thin sheets.

Complete step by step answer:
Metal is the substance which possesses high thermal and electrical conductivity. They are electropositive in nature as they have the potential to donate electrons and generally acquire positive charge. Along with these properties metal possesses various other properties as well.
Other properties of metals are as follows:
$1$. Metals are lustrous in nature which means they can be polished when freshly prepared.
$2$. Metals can be beaten into very thin sheets. This property of metal is called malleability.
$3$. Metals can be drawn into thin wires very easily. This property of metal is known as ductility.

$5$. Metals act as conductors in nature because they allow electricity to pass through them.
$6$. Metals are electropositive in nature.
$7$. Metal possesses high thermal and electrical conductivity.
Sulphur, chlorine and fluorine are non-metals. That is why none of them possesses the properties of metals. They are not lustrous, ductile and malleable in nature. They do not act as conductors and also do not possess high thermal and electrical conductivity.
Aluminum is a metal. So, it possesses all the properties of metals which means it can be beaten into very thin sheets. It is malleable in nature.
Therefore, option, ‘B. Aluminum’ is correct.
